Output 2996b390d266bca959bb981eb02141c7e690c5c176c285e68a1e58dc19278660:0

value
701700
script pubkey
OP_0 OP_PUSHBYTES_20 ecb41ce5623eba53b137f9caf8ac262d4cdf9e70
address
bc1qaj6peetz86a98vfhl8903tpx94xdl8nsmucq23
transaction
2996b390d266bca959bb981eb02141c7e690c5c176c285e68a1e58dc19278660